#bf5122 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#bf5122 is composed of 74.9% red, 31.8% green and 13.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 57.6% magenta, 82.2% yellow and 25.1% black. It has a hue angle of 18 degrees, a saturation of 69.8% and a lightness of 44.1%. #bf5122 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a244 with #7f0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6633.

● #bf5122 color description : Strong orange.
The hexadecimal color #bf5122 has RGB values of R:191, G:81, B:34 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.58, Y:0.82,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 12538146.
